What should I expect at my first urology appointment with Dr. Vourganti?

Your first visit will typically include a review of your medical history, a physical examination, and a discussion of any symptoms you have been experiencing. Diagnostic tests such as urinalysis or imaging may be ordered depending on your concerns. The goal is to arrive at an accurate diagnosis before recommending any treatment.
